About This Clues Answer
We think the answer is "SAINT" which means:
- noun
- • A person who has died and has been declared a saint by canonization
- • Person of exceptional holiness
- • Model of excellence or perfection of a kind; one having no equal verb
- • Hold sacred
- • Declare (a dead person) to be a saint
An example sentence would be:
- • "St. patrick is the patron saint of ireland."
- • "Mother teresa is considered a modern-day saint for her humanitarian work."
